Dolphin Defenders St. Maarten
Dolphin Defenders, St. Maarten Our mission is to: 1) Stop any and all current plans for captive dolphins and all other marine mammals on St. Maarten. 2) Have it written into the Law of country St. Maarten that there will be no form of Marine Mammal captivity, in any type of facility, for any reason whatsoever, now or in the future. 3) Bring awareness to the island of St. Maarten in regards to the importance of protecting the freedom of dolphins and other marine mammals from the negative and cruel captive dolphin and marine mammal industry, destructive fishing practices and environmental hazards in our waters and internationally. We are going to do this by: 1) By petitioning the government not to permit the establishment of such a facility in Country St Maarten. 2) By lobbying the government to have it written into the Law of country St. Maarten that there will be no form of Marine Mammal captivity, in any type of facility, for any reason whatsoever, now or in the future. 3) Making available to the island of St. Maarten, from young to old, information regarding the negative and cruel captive dolphin and marine mammal industry, destructive fishing practices and environmental hazards both in our waters and internationally – education starts at home.
